卷积神经网络可视化在语音识别中的应用是什么?

在人工智能领域,语音识别技术已经取得了显著的进展。而卷积神经网络(Convolutional Neural Network,简称CNN)作为一种强大的深度学习模型,在语音识别中的应用越来越广泛。本文将深入探讨卷积神经网络可视化在语音识别中的应用,并分析其优势与挑战。

一、卷积神经网络概述

卷积神经网络是一种模拟人脑视觉神经结构的深度学习模型,由多个卷积层、池化层和全连接层组成。卷积层用于提取特征,池化层用于降低特征的空间维度,全连接层用于分类。卷积神经网络在图像识别、语音识别等领域取得了显著的成果。

二、卷积神经网络可视化

卷积神经网络可视化是指通过可视化技术将卷积神经网络的内部结构和特征提取过程展现出来。这有助于我们更好地理解模型的运作原理,优化模型结构,提高识别准确率。

三、卷积神经网络可视化在语音识别中的应用

  1. 特征提取可视化

语音识别过程中,首先需要从语音信号中提取特征。卷积神经网络通过卷积层提取语音信号的时频特征,如Mel频率倒谱系数(MFCC)等。通过可视化卷积神经网络的卷积层,我们可以直观地看到模型如何提取特征。


  1. 层次特征可视化

卷积神经网络具有多个卷积层,每个卷积层提取的特征具有不同的层次。通过可视化不同层次的卷积层,我们可以了解模型如何逐步提取语音信号的深层特征。


  1. 注意力机制可视化

在语音识别任务中,注意力机制可以帮助模型关注语音信号中的关键信息。通过可视化注意力机制,我们可以了解模型如何分配注意力,从而提高识别准确率。

四、案例分析

以一个基于卷积神经网络的语音识别系统为例,我们通过可视化技术分析了其特征提取和层次特征提取过程。

  1. 特征提取可视化

通过可视化卷积神经网络的卷积层,我们发现模型主要提取了语音信号的时频特征。这些特征在语音识别过程中起到了关键作用。


  1. 层次特征可视化

通过可视化不同层次的卷积层,我们发现低层卷积层主要提取语音信号的局部特征,如音素;高层卷积层则提取语音信号的语义特征,如词汇和句子。


  1. 注意力机制可视化

通过可视化注意力机制,我们发现模型在识别过程中关注了语音信号中的关键信息,如元音和辅音。这有助于提高模型的识别准确率。

五、总结

卷积神经网络可视化在语音识别中的应用具有重要意义。通过可视化技术,我们可以更好地理解模型的运作原理,优化模型结构,提高识别准确率。然而,卷积神经网络可视化也面临着一些挑战,如可视化结果的解释性、可视化方法的多样性等。未来,随着可视化技术的不断发展,卷积神经网络可视化在语音识别中的应用将更加广泛。

猜你喜欢:全链路监控